Output 3761dba68c56c2d3881a3ddba9bf6c95c2109d105d08d75cb2365e23bf3f13fa:0

value
2740068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c86635cc337765aeab6bbb439f174c46728f53 OP_EQUAL
address
3MYYd9yTiCaLLQbUSF2bXN24cGetoegqAz
transaction
3761dba68c56c2d3881a3ddba9bf6c95c2109d105d08d75cb2365e23bf3f13fa
confirmations
318275
spent
true